Job summaryThis post is pending college approval Substantive Consultant in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ery. This is a replacement full time post for a Substantive Consultant to support a busy regional unit which is expanding. The post is mainly based at the Queen's Medical Centre campus of Nottingham University Hospitals NHS Trust. It also involves clinics at Sherwood Forest NHS trust.
Main duties of the jobIt is expected that you are flexible in terms of operating lists and that you may be asked to undertake additional Programmed Activities. The initial job is planned at 10 PA's. Candidates who wish to apply as part of a job share arrangement will also be considered.
This post is pending college approval About usThe unit provides regional head and neck services for Nottinghamshire, Sherwood Forest and Lincolnshire. You will be part of our team and it is expected that you will bring expertise in the development and provision of new services and share the long term vision of the Oral and Maxillofacial Unit.
This post is pending college approvalJob description Job responsibilitiesMFDS/FDS and FRCS qualification with inclusion on the specialist list, CCT expected within 6 months of interview date, full GDC and GMC registration are essential.

Disclosure and Barring Service CheckThis post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.
Certificate of SponsorshipApplications from job seekers who require current Skilled worker s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ications. For further information visit the .
From 6 April 2017, skilled worker applicants, applying for entry clearance into the UK, have had to present a criminal record certificate from each country they have resided continuously or cumulatively for 12 months or more in the past 10 years. Adult dependants (over 18 years old) are also subject to this requirement. .
